Chapter 1 - Confidence is the extension among considerations and activities. How regularly have you thought back on discussions or openings in your day-to-day existence and thought "I wish I had said/done that"? Maybe it wasn't so much as a serious deal, yet something little that was inside your ability to accomplish, yet you didn't feel sufficiently confident to attempt it. The vast majority of us have felt this way on various occasions for the duration of our lives. Lamentably, on the off chance that we need confidence, we like to remain inert, and, unfortunately, this is by all accounts especially articulated for ladies. Confidence implies having sufficient faith in our capacities that we become dynamic. Absence of confidence, thusly, implies being dubious of whether our endeavors will be fruitful – a vulnerability that makes us terrified to try and attempt. A reasonable illustration of this can be found in an examination by educator Zach Estes, who had understudies tackle convoluted riddle tests. From the start, it appeared to Estes that the male understudies had performed better compared to the female understudies. In any case, after looking into it further, Estes saw that a large number of the ladies had left a ton of the inquiries unanswered. Thus, Estes requested that the understudies retake the test and, this time, to ensure they answer every inquiry. The outcome? The ladies performed similarly just like the men. In any case, for what reason did the ladies decide to not endeavor a response to a significant number of the inquiries? The focal issue was the ladies' absence of confidence: they liked to leave a clear space instead of hazard offering some unacceptable response. In the present circumstance, having confidence would have taken them to take the jump and attempt. Yet, imagine a scenario where hopefulness assumed a part, as opposed to confidence. All things considered, idealism – the demeanor that everything will be alright – is diverse to confidence, which alludes to making a move. Being idealistic aides, however, can prompt activity that improves confidence. We know at that point, that trust in our capacities is urgent towards turning out to be practitioners. Chapter 3 - Ladies' absence of confidence assumes a negative part in the business world. Living in a man's reality is hard, however, working in a man's reality is significantly harder. Because of an absence of confidence, ladies will in general acknowledge more awful work conditions than men do. Numerous ladies essentially don't feel adequately sure to put themselves out there: for example, regardless of whether they have smart thoughts, they are more outlandish than men are to propose them to the chief. The business world is serious and without a solid portion of confidence, it's incomprehensible for one to flourish there. To just enter the labor force, we should have the option to introduce ourselves in the best light – which necessitates that we see ourselves in this light too. One way we see a distinction in how people introduce themselves is in the arrangement. A financial aspects teacher at Carnegie Mellon University deduced in a progression of studies that men arrange their compensation multiple times more regularly than ladies. Furthermore, in any event, when ladies do arrange, they hope to get 30% to a lesser degree a boost in compensation than men do. Also, the business world requires a specific measure of self-advancement and self-activity, which are unthinkable without confidence. Rather than the school homeroom, where accomplishing quality work is sufficient to get you seen, in the business world we can't depend on our work to justify itself with real evidence. So, we need to get ourselves taken note of. However, without confidence, we stay quiet, which brings about botched freedoms, like advancements. This is particularly the situation for ladies. For instance, a Princeton research group found that ladies talk up to 75 percent less frequently than men do, when there are a larger number of men than ladies in the room. Along these lines, regardless of whether a lady has the best business thought, she's undeniably more averse to propose it in a room loaded with male partners. You can perceive how this may block her advancement! At this point, it ought to be confident that confidence is a significant apparatus throughout everyday life. In any event, when ladies are proficient, they frequently don't feel confident. This meddles with their mentality, however, it additionally keeps them from advancing. It's essential to recognize confidence, the faith in our capacities by and large, and the ability, the information on our capabilities in a specific field. Confidence isn't constantly founded on skill. Numerous ladies feel awkward and ill-equipped, regardless of whether they are skilled at their positions. One model is Christine Lagarde, Managing Director of the International Monetary Fund and, hence, perhaps the most powerful ladies on the planet. All things considered, she concedes in a meeting with the creators that she not just had confidence issues while moving gradually up the progressive system yet even now has snapshots of weakness. Low confidence keeps us from reaching adequately skyward to advance. It makes us awkward as well as is a condition that makes us focus on short of what we need since we don't believe it's feasible to accomplish our objectives. Having low confidence implies that we can't imagine what we need, thus we don't work for it. On the off chance that you look in the mirror and don't see a pilot, you won't ever take flight exercises! A fascinating illustration of what self-assurance means for activity can be found in therapist David Dunning's test, which interrogates understudies concerning their confidence. Female understudies showed radically lower levels of trust in the rating of their capacities and accomplishments than male understudies. At that point, when Dunning welcomed the understudies to partake in a challenge, just 49% of the female understudies joined, while 71% of the male understudies did. From this, we see that negative self-discernment brought about by an absence of confidence can make ladies botch openings.
